Product Description
- The Muskie Act is a very strict law enacted in the United States to regulate exhaust gas emissions (environmental protection).
- Complying with this law is expected to require advanced technology and high development costs, leaving American automakers, including the Big Three, scrambling to decide what to do.
- In 1972, Honda released the first-generation Civic, which was equipped with a low-emission engine that incorporated a technology named CVCC (Compound Vortex Controlled Combustion), and thus met the law. It is known for overturning the notion of Japanese cars in America at the time, which was that cheap meant bad quality.
- Since then, the Civic has become synonymous with Honda cars in America and has been loved by people of all ages and genders to this day.
- The motif of Hot Wheels is the fourth generation model that appeared in 1987, known as the EF type and nicknamed `Grand Civic` in Japan.
- It was very well received, with its wide and low proportions and its light, powerful engine.
- The Civic is also popular with American 'tuner' fans who further improve the engine, lower the ride height, and customize the appearance, and the Hot Wheels EF type is finished in a style that reflects these trends.
